
M = Meetings A meeting is arranged by individuals or an organisation.
I = Incentive Travel A trip arranged by a company for an employee or individual as a reward for his or her satisfactory performance. As such it is a managerial motivational tool.
C = Conventions / Conferences A meeting of people in the same profession to exchange information. The term used is dependant on the country however the countries use the terms fluidly and are not confined to the use of one term only. Congress is used in USA, Convention in Asia and Conference in Europe and the Pacific. Generally the terms “Congress” and “Convention” indicate larger and more complex arrangements and numbers of participants than “Conference”.

1- MICE closely related to the tourism industry because, it is a significant market segment for tourism and hosopitality industry in many destinations worldwide. And also part of the business tourism, more stable with arrangement booked well in advance. MICE foreign visitors spend higher than general visitors 3-4 times on average. MICE also help to promote the tourist attraction within the country, especaily create more jobs for the local people, and also revenue to the accomodation industry like hotel, restaurant, resort, spa and also help to inhance the destinations.
2- The shortcomings in the meeting industry today such as
* Limited market intelligence, lack of reliable statistics and regular research to provide a base of intelligence and information on trends and on the size and value of the industry.
* Non-standardized terminology, lake of an accepted and properly defined terminology such as business tourism (in Europe), business event (in Australia). "MEEC", "MICE" , "MC&IT". Also, Convention, Conference, Congress, and Meeting. And an on-line initiative : APEX by CIC to make further progress in standardizing and providing a common source for industry definitions.
* Underdeveloped educational framework : Formal training and educational courses are needed. For many of these working in the industry, it is a 2nd or 3rd career. They have come into conference work from other disciplines, e.g. hotel & catering, travel, sales & marketing, public administration.

4- PCO is a Profesional Convention/Congress Organizer. is a focused and dedicated group of experienced managers who will deliver the best possible forum of international standards anywhere in the world, with emphasis on quality sales, marketing, and management.
5- DMO is a Destination Marketing Organizations, is a not-for-profit organization supported by government budget allocations private memberships, transient room taxes (in USA) or a combination of these three primary responsibility :
- To encourage groups to hold meetings. convensions and trade shows in the city or area if represents.
- To assist those groups with their meetings and meeting preparations.
- To encourge tourists to visit and enjoy the historic, cultural, and recreational oppornities and destination offers.
*The DMO can do for the meeting planners such as :
+ To encourage group to hold meetings in the city and assists groups with meeting preparations.
+ To provide promotional meterials to encourage attendance and establish room blocks.
